Output bcaf77b668b5f14463c7e5cc4ce7119a9ad1f9ee408df2fdabb821a878d34d66:2

value
590779
script pubkey
OP_0 OP_PUSHBYTES_20 6e84c9118107dec54dd6136be51fc9c8909c0829
address
bc1qd6zvjyvpql0v2nwkzd47287fezgfczpf3gacvq
transaction
bcaf77b668b5f14463c7e5cc4ce7119a9ad1f9ee408df2fdabb821a878d34d66
spent
true